LearnDash Pricing
LearnDash has flexible, scalable pricing options that run the gamut from your solo educator to large institutional organizations. Understand these price options so you can choose how best to achieve your financial goals:
- Basic Plan: This plan is ideal for independent trainers or small organizations and encompasses the basic functionalities of creating and managing courses. It’s perfect for those starting with a few courses and minimal customization needs.
Cost: $199 per year. - Ultimate Course Creator: Aimed at mid-sized businesses and educators with broader e-learning objectives, this plan includes advanced features and additional integrations. It’s well-suited for managing more extensive course catalogs and a growing student base.
Cost: $229 annually for a comprehensive toolset to support ambitious projects. - Student Success Bundle: This bundle combines the LearnDash LMS with Notes and Gradebook add-ons, which are tailored for those prioritizing student achievement. It’s an excellent choice for tracking student progress and improving outcomes.
Pricing: $249 per year for a single site (save $48) or $297 per year if bought separately.
When deciding on a plan, think about the future growth of your platform. If unsure, starting with the Basic Plan or consulting a LearnDash developer can help guide your choice.
LearnDash Themes
Your front end first gives students an impression of your website. It is essential to have it user-friendly and appealing to the eyes. Choosing the right theme for LearnDash is crucial to achieve this. Here are the available options:
- Free LearnDash Themes: A popular free theme, Astra, is a good starting point. These themes offer basic compatibility but usually have limited customization options. In addition, free themes typically don’t provide regular updates and support, which may lead to future security risks and outdated designs.
- Premium LearnDash Themes: Premium themes are worth spending on for an advanced and professional look and feel. They offer tremendous scope for designing, built-in SEO optimization, and constant updates to keep your site safe and modern. The prices of premium LearnDash themes range from $30 to $200, depending on the level of customization and features included.
The proper theme selected will give your platform functionality and fun, allowing your students to learn seamlessly.
LearnDash Plugins
Plugins are the tools that help you enhance your LearnDash site’s functionality. They can be used to customize and expand your e-learning platform according to your specific requirements. Here’s what you can do:
- Free Plugins: The WordPress plugin repository offers a wide range of free plugins that cover all the basic features. While these plugins can handle foundational tasks effectively, they often lack advanced capabilities and dedicated support. Premium plugins are usually a better choice for more robust features.
- Premium LearnDash Plugins: The premium plugins are potent instruments for bringing the e-learning platform to a more developed level. These could consist of the following features:
- Advanced analytics for courses
- More complicated quizzes
- Several tools aimed at increasing students’ engagement
Popular options include:
- MemberPress: A membership management plugin that simplifies creating membership-based courses. Pricing starts at around $149 per year.
- BuddyPress: Social networking features for your site to enable users to connect, communicate, and collaborate. While the core version is free, a pro version with enhanced features is available.
- WooCommerce: Facilitates smooth course sales and e-commerce integration. The base plugin is free, but premium extensions may come with additional costs.

Primary Factors Determining the Cost of Custom LearnDash Development
Platform Complexity and Feature Requirements
The complexity of your requirements is the most significant factor influencing the cost of custom LearnDash development. Simple adjustments, such as basic course structures or minor interface updates, are budget-friendly and easy to implement.
In contrast, advanced features like gamified quizzes, detailed reporting, complex user roles, or integrations with external systems require higher technical expertise and increase development expenses. For instance, institutions seeking tools such as custom group management, live video integration, or real-time assignment feedback will face higher costs due to the specialized work involved.
Timeline and Project Scope
The scope of custom LearnDash development can vary widely, from implementing a single feature to completely tailoring an LMS to your needs. Projects with tight deadlines or intricate requirements often demand additional resources, which can increase costs. Frequent changes during development, known as scope creep, can further impact budget and timeline.
Set clear goals and project scope early to manage costs and keep the project on track.

Breakdown of Custom LearnDash Development Costs
Planning, Strategy, and Design
The planning phase is crucial for defining your project goals and setting a clear direction. During this stage, requirements are gathered, and research is conducted to ensure the project’s success. In this stage, wireframes or mockups are developed to create a design basis. This stage typically entails 10% to 15% of the cost of an overall project. A well-designed interface will ensure that your LMS has your brand as its image and provides seamless integration for your students.
Development Costs
This phase is coding, integration, and functional testing, and it usually accounts for the most significant part of your project cost, about 40% to 60% of the total cost. The price can differ depending on factors like the complexity of user roles, compatibility with plugins and themes, and integrations with third-party platforms like WooCommerce, MemberPress, or external APIs. These elements require much care and technical expertise that directly influence the time and resources needed to complete the project.
Testing and Post-Launch Support
After building the platform, it needs thorough testing to ensure it runs and has no bugs. This includes helping out after the launch, fixing any issues that pop up, adding new stuff, and making sure it works well with the latest WordPress versions. This takes about 10-20% of the entire project’s cost. Keeping up with support helps your LMS stay in good shape, safe, and current for the people using it.
Unseen Expenses in LearnDash Custom Development
Third-Party Integration Fees
Many custom LearnDash integrations require third-party service integrations to enhance your site’s functionality, such as payment processing, email marketing, or analytics tools. You may incur recurring fees associated with platforms like MemberPress and Zoom or integrations with other services.
Server and Hosting Requirements
A LearnDash platform with extensive customization requires more robust hosting resources to perform optimally. A VPS (Virtual Private Server) or managed WordPress hosting plan is recommended for such needs, as these plans allocate dedicated resources for demanding applications like LearnDash.
If your courses include video lessons, you’ll need hosting to handle video streaming without causing slow load times. Investing in a Content Delivery Network (CDN) or a video hosting service like Vimeo or Wistia is crucial to ensure smooth delivery. When aligned with your budget, these options ensure fast and reliable course delivery for all users.
